US massively deploys special forces and aircraft closer to Venezuela - WSJ
The United States is carrying out a large-scale redeployment of aviation and special forces closer to Venezuela. This was reported by The Wall Street Journal citing sources in the defence ministry.
Details of tipping
According to the publication, such movements have been recorded in recent days:
from the airbase Cannon in the state of New Mexico, at least 10 CV-22 Osprey aircraft, The US Special Operations Forces have been using them for a number of years;
to Puerto Rico heavy transport aircraft arrived C-17, that took off from the bases Fort Stewart і Fort Campbell;
aviation transported military personnel and equipment, However, the details of the mission are not officially disclosed.
Departments involved
Cannon Air Force Base is home to 27th Special Operations Regiment of the US Air Force. Fort Campbell is home to 160th Special Operations Aviation Regiment and 101st Airborne Division.
These divisions specialise in:
high risk transactions;
infiltration and exfiltration;
evacuation missions;
combat support and rapid response.
Context.
The increased US military activity in the Caribbean comes amid rising tensions over Venezuela. The Pentagon has not yet provided any official explanation for the purpose of the deployment, but the scale of the operation suggests Preparing for rapid response or show of force scenarios.
